“One Video Message Is Worth 1000 Voicemails” – Motorola Launches Video Mail for the Ojo™ Personal Video Phone

SCHAUMBERG, Ill. – 25 July 2005 – Leave a message and don’t forget to smile! Motorola, Inc. (NYSE: MOT) tonight introduced Ojo Video Mail – a new way to stay connected to the ones you love – for the popular Motorola Ojo™ Personal Video Phone.

With Ojo Video Mail, you’ll never miss another video call. A new twist on the old answering machine idea, this new feature lets you record a personalized video greeting that callers automatically receive when you’re not available to answer your Ojo Personal Video Phone. Callers can then record a video message, which Ojo will save for you to playback later on. A new menu item on the Ojo main screen shows when you have messages waiting and how many, and a simple push of a button lets you view saved messages at your convenience.

Like live video calls made through the Motorola Ojo, Video Mail offers high-quality video with synchronized audio. So whether it’s a baby’s first tooth or a simple call to say “I Love You,” Ojo Video Mail will capture the moment in real time and save it for whenever you are ready.

Ojo Video Mail will be available on the Ojo Personal Video Phone later this summer. The feature will be downloaded automatically to existing Ojo users, who will see the new feature on their Ojo main screen as soon as Video Mail has been added.

The Motorola Ojo is the first true-to-life video phone to provide Video Mail, a feature which perfectly complements the face-to-face conversations that consumers are already having with the product. The Motorola Ojo works over any high-speed Internet connection, and is designed to keep friends, family and co-workers seamlessly connected.

Motorola worked with WorldGate Communications (NASDAQ: WGAT, www.wgate.com), a leading developer of video telephony technologies, to bring the Ojo Personal Video Phone to market. WorldGate’s patented industrial design and patent-pending innovations for Ojo include a state-of-the-art optimization of the advanced MPEG-4 coding standard (H.264), which enables transmission of 30 frames-per-second video with synchronized audio at data rates as low as 100 Kbps. This allows the Motorola Ojo to work within the upstream data rates for both DSL and cable broadband networks, and ensures that existing broadband infrastructures can handle video phone traffic.
